Each relay has three contacts(C, NO, and NC). Internal Circuit Diagram for Single Channel Relay Module. Is it possible to post the values of R1 and R2? The CS pin is connected to the PB0(8) of the Atmega328 digital pin. $14.99 $19.29 Save $4.30. All contacts on each relay are available externally on screw terminals for easy user access. Schematic: VCC and RY-VCC are also the power supply of the relay module. Here’s a simple animation … On the AC side connect your feed to Common (middle contact) and use NC or NO according to your needs. Q. A relay can be used to control high voltage electronic devices such as motors and as well as low voltage electronic devices such as a light bulb or a fan. Wiring Diagrams; About Us; Contact Us; Kidde Sm120x Relay Wiring Diagram. 5. A relay is a type of a switch that acts as an interface between microcontrollers and AC Loads. Also, why is there a optocoupler at all? This 8 channel 5V relay has both optical and magnetic isolation, providing a lot of protection to the inputs from electrical faults on the outputs. The timekeeping operation continues while the part operates from the backup supply. Used to trigger(On/Off) the Relay, Normally one end is connected to 5V and the other end to ground. The onboard programmable relays, digital I/O’s, analog inputs, Real-Time Clock(RTC) and Micro SD memory card slot make this module useful for learning as well as making sophisticated applications. The following photo shows the Arduino Uno running the sketch listed above with the relay wired to two led strips and a 12v battery. Since this module uses USB as the underlying transport mechanism, most of the serial parameters do not affect the communication. Coil End 2 . It can be used to control various appliances and equipment with large current. It is important to take additional care when using relays with inductive loads. The popular ULN2003 IC is used to drive the relays individually, the inputs of the ULN2003 IC are connected to the Atmega328P digital pins(PD2, PD3, PB1, PD7) and the outputs of the ULN2003 IC are connected to relays(0, 1,2 & 3) respectively. Am newbie to Arduino I have 2 Relay Module opto isolated and Arduino UNO i have written simple program to control relay i have connected vcc to 5v from arduino and GND TO GND from arduino also JD-VCC and vcc are short circuits. When the switch is not pressed, the pull-up resistor will cause the DIGITAL IO to stay at the VDD voltage level. September 3, 2018 July 31, 2018 by Larry A. Wellborn. This module also includes Digital I/Os(multiplexed with PWM outputs), analog inputs, I2C Interface, Real-Time Clock using DS1307, Micro SD Card Slot for storage, these can be accessed over a USB interface and program easily with Arduino IDE for extended functionality. Note down the name of the serial port (COM9). There is an excellent article on designing back emf suppression on Wikipedia at http://en.wikipedia.org/wiki/Flyback_diode. All Numato products can be ordered directly from our web store http://www.numato.com. Please write to [email protected] for a quote. My problem is Led from relay works fine but my relay coil is not energized. Save my name, email, and website in this browser for the next time I comment. Page 3 2 Channel USB Relay Module – User Guide Introduction Numato Lab's 2 Channel USB Relay Module is a versatile product for controlling your electrical and electronic devices remotely from a PC over USB link. Working is simple, we need to … This product is compatible with the following operating systems. It has a standard interface that can be controlled directly by microcontroller. 9. The board has four 12VDC SPDT mechanical relays that can switch up to 10A. Introducing the Relay Module A relay is an electrically operated switch that can be turned on or off, letting the current go through or not, and can be controlled with low voltages, like the 5V provided by the Arduino pins. Skip to content. http://arduino.cc/en/main/software). By default, the board is configured to use the +5V supply from USB. 10A 30V DC The following circuit diagram shows the relay module with the input isolated from the relay. Even though the back emf lives only for a very short time (a few milliseconds) it can cause sparks between the relay contacts and can deteriorate the contact quality over time and reduce the life span for the relays considerably. The input voltage range of the ADC is 0 – VDD (this product uses a 5V power supply, so the range will be 0 – 5V). Thre relay is already separated from the mains voltage. A diode used for this purpose is usually called a freewheeling diode. I have explained this smart relay module circuit in the tutorial video of this home automation project. The clock/calendar provides seconds, minutes, hours, day, date, month, and year information. Arduino 2 Channel Relay: This instructable is for connecting your Arduino to a 2 Channel relay module and using your sketch to control the switches.I bought the 2 Relay Module on eBay (for $9.50) to drive … then connect the relays input pin (the pin comes from the transistor's base pin) to the Arduino's digital pin 13. then upload the code. The fundamental idea of using a switch with DIGITAL IO is to have the switch cause a voltage level change at the DIGITAL IO pin when pressed. In this example, we will connect the relay module with Arduino in the normally open state. The logic circuit uses +5V supply and the relay coils use +12V supply. There is no special command is required to execute to switch between analog and digital mode. In most cases, USB ports are capable of providing enough current for the module. The 8 channel relay module has its own optocoupler also called opto-isolator, photocoupler or optical isolator. The module communicates with the host PC over a full-speed USB link. 5V Relay Pin Diagram [Click the image to enlarge it] Relay Pin Configuration. When connected to PC, the module will appear as a serial port in Windows Device Manager (or a serial tty device in Linux and Mac). Relay Module A relay is basically a switch which is operated by an electromagnet. In order to do this, you need to understand How to Control a R… Four Channel Relay Module The four channel relay module and the two channel relay module work the same way. Is achieved by using an external +5V power is not optional and ground! Planning to use a relay module the four channel relay module using the “ IO. Equiped with high-current relays that work under AC250V 10A or DC30V 10A the ISP PB3! Am/Pm indicator pins makes corresponding relay off is automatically adjusted for months with fewer than 31,... The USB to serial Chip FT232RL helps to program boot loader, this... Four 12VDC SPDT mechanical relays that work under AC250V 10A or DC30V 10A, but other operating principles are used. Email, and transformers the logic circuit can be read using the Arduino as. A light bulb or a ceiling Fan version of this product its own also! Minutes, hours, day, date, month, and each channel a. Download link series resistor to protect relay contacts shipped with back emf when switch. An electromagnetic switch operated by a relatively small current that can switch up to.... 5-Pin relay module has two SPDT relays which can switch: 10A 250V AC 10A 30V DC this. Can also be used as a number starting at zero and ending at 1023 ]... Use with DIGITAL IOs Arduino in the normally open and normally closed positions product, Numato... Principles like Motors, Solenoids, and website in this document provides,! By sending simple numbers to the Arduino with the relay module to the PB0 ( 8 ) of the is. Loader on to AVR ( Atmega168/Atmega328 ) 16-Channel relay interface board, and website this! Date is automatically adjusted for months with fewer than 31 days, including corrections for leap year use with IOs. A. Wellborn, minutes, hours, day, date, month, and ). Thermal relays mentioned below should be excluded from this description channel needs a 15-20mA driver current the. ) the relay that helps a PC/Linux/Mac computer to communicate and control this module voltage.... ’ re controlling a relay is turned off and will be disconnected when the switch can be through! Relay wired to two LED strips and a 12V battery is a task Best left to the board the module. A diode used for various custom applications and RY-VCC are also used, as. A switch that acts as an interface between microcontrollers and AC loads value when to. Drivers pre-installed many countries where you can place your order execute to switch relay. A to Mini B cable for connecting with PC the 5 channel relay module Pinout Internal circuit shows. 5-Pin relay module ; LED ; circuit Diagram and Explanation for AC and DC loads mode the. Mode, each DIGITAL IO to stay at the VDD voltage level relay normally! Driver page a wide variety of chips that support I2C communication on working with electrical mains or other voltages. To withstand the back emf when the relay, normally one end is connected 5V. The motor of relay animation … KY-019 connection Diagram is the complete circuit Diagram for this product listed! Same way is powered from USB or onboard 5V regulator from external +12V supply for the relay, normally end! Such home automation project //www.ftdichip.com/FTDrivers.htm for more details quickly to the Arduino 's 5 volt pin and GND.! Driver is installed properly, the device should appear as a serial port is. ( default jumper settings should work in most cases they are shipped the! Relay control sketch is uploaded to the marking on the header powered USB! Mains voltage the power supply of the Atmega328 DIGITAL pin and transformers wide variety chips... Same way days, including corrections for leap year operates in either the or... The expected load current feature-rich product that can switch: 10A 250V AC 10A 30V DC Although this be... The PB0 ( 8 ) of the Arduino serial monitor electronic devices in with. Indicates VDD ( 5V for this purpose AC and DC loads parameters do affect. Custom applications can control much larger current save my name, email, NC... ; kidde Sm120x relay Wiring Diagram New Glen s home automation project to connecting with PC! Result in injury and or death two circuits leap year cause damage to the supply... Sending simple numbers to the module communicates with the required drivers pre-installed visit:. So we believe this is a 12V 16-Channel relay interface board, be able to control the communicates... Input and 1023 indicates VDD ( 5V for this purpose is usually called a freewheeling diode or snubber circuit the... Automation project preprogrammed firmware and offer limited customizability the usual Songle SRD-05VDC-SL-C relays damage to the PB0 8... The selected device can vary depending on the board has 4 analog input pins that supports CDC!